Buhari mourns Kemi Nelson
President Muhammadu Buhari on Sunday expressed regret over the demise of former Deputy National Woman Leader of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Kemi Nelson, who dies on Sunday at the age of 66 years.
President Buhari in a statement in Abuja eulogized Kemi Nelson as a “consistent and faithful party member who devoted so much to the evolution, development, sustenance and relevance of the party in Lagos and around the country.”
The president acknowledged her contributions when she was Commissioner for Women Affairs and Poverty Alleviation in Lagos State, State Women Leader, National Deputy Women Leader of APC, and Executive Director of the Nigerian Social Insurance Trust Fund. He observed that she was such a grassroots mobiliser and an achiever who left her footprints wherever she served.
President Buhari prayed that Almighty God will grant the husband, Adeyemi Nelson, and the family, friends and associates of the deceased, the fortitude to bear the loss and repose her soul.
